Virtual Hosting effect on SEO

if a website is hosted on a virtual host does it have any effect on the website from SEO Perspective?
either on the 1st website or on the other?

Correct me if I'm wrong, but I believe they only penalize domains that share the IP if they are trying to benefit from linking to one another. If you have two unrelated sites hosted on the same IP, you should not suffer any penalization.

I think this is a debate that will continue to go on and on.

I've read in other forums that their has not been any evidence of any site being hurt from linking to sites from same ip address only link farm related sites.

I'm not sure if sites are hurt if they trade links with sites with same IP but I try to split sites I own on different locations to try to combat that just in case. Yes it is usually cheaper to host multiple sites in one spot but to be on save site I divide them on 4-5 differnt locations.

I don't think a few number of links between sites sharing same ip is bad, but I would say there would be a number where may be a threashlevel.
